Baseball

Let's Play Ball! Baseball Canada hit it out of the park when it adopted Challenger Baseball into its family of programs. Now kids with cognitive and/or physical disabilities can find a league of their own and play on an organized baseball team.

Challenger Baseball is a great team sport within a supportive and encouraging atmosphere. Players can even get a "buddy" to help them navigate the game for better success. The program allows for participation at all levels of ability, structured to the player's abilities with the philosophy of "Play. Just for fun!"
